Rounding of First Order Transitions in Low-Dimensional Quantum Systems with Quenched Disorder

arXiv:0907.2419 · doi:10.1103/PhysRevLett.103.197201

Abstract

We prove that the addition of an arbitrarily small random perturbation of a suitable type to a quantum spin system rounds a first order phase transition in the conjugate order parameter in d <= 2 dimensions, or in systems with continuous symmetry in d <= 4. This establishes rigorously for quantum systems the existence of the Imry-Ma phenomenon, which for classical systems was proven by Aizenman and Wehr.
